Sr. Software Development Engineer, Adobe FireFly

Adobe changes the world through digital experiences, providing tools for emerging artists to global brands to design and deliver exceptional digital experiences.
$153,600 - $286,600
Frontend
Senior Software Engineer
Hybrid
5,000+ Employees
7+ years of experience
AI

Description For Sr. Software Development Engineer, Adobe FireFly

Adobe is seeking a Senior Software Development Engineer to join their Firefly team, focusing on building next-generation AI-powered creative tools. This role offers an exciting opportunity to shape emerging products that will reach millions of creators worldwide. As part of Adobe's mission to change the world through digital experiences, you'll work on the Adobe Firefly client platform, implementing AI/ML powered tools that empower self-expression and collaboration across the digital landscape.

The position requires expertise in JavaScript/TypeScript and React, with a focus on building high-performance, reliable, and maintainable code. You'll be part of a highly collaborative team working closely with product teams and stakeholders to architect and maintain the user-facing experience for Adobe Firefly. The ideal candidate should have a user-centric, detail-oriented approach and enjoy independently solving complex problems while maintaining a strong team orientation.

Adobe offers a competitive compensation package and a collaborative work environment at their beautiful downtown San Jose campus. The company is committed to diversity, inclusion, and creating exceptional employee experiences. This role provides an opportunity to work with cutting-edge AI technology while contributing to tools that empower creative professionals worldwide. The position offers both technical challenges and the chance to impact how millions of users interact with creative tools.

Last updated 17 days ago

Responsibilities For Sr. Software Development Engineer, Adobe FireFly

  • Help establish architecture and quality coding practices for the Adobe Firefly client platform
  • Define long-term solutions for component based architecture using functional programming
  • Work closely with the design team, product management and internal clients translating early ideas into interactive prototypes
  • Engage with customers to identify problems, A|B test solutions, and refine workflows
  • Expand your knowledge and skills to stay ahead of the latest development, test, and deployment methodologies

Requirements For Sr. Software Development Engineer, Adobe FireFly

TypeScript
JavaScript
React
  • 7+ years of professional experience developing interactive web applications
  • B.S or higher in Computer Science, or equivalent experience
  • Well established practice of building and deploying web applications using React
  • High proficiency in TypeScript or JavaScript (ES6+)
  • Fluent with Test Driven Development (TDD)
  • Fluent in functional programming style
  • Confidence to be an opinionated, pragmatic developer
  • Ability to perform independently in a hybrid or remote first work environment

Benefits For Sr. Software Development Engineer, Adobe FireFly

  • Competitive salary range: $153,600 - $286,600 annually
  • Hybrid work environment
  • Beautiful downtown San Jose campus
  • Collaborative work environment
  • Opportunity to work with cutting-edge AI technology

Interested in this job?

Jobs Related To Adobe Sr. Software Development Engineer, Adobe FireFly

Senior Software Development Engineer, App Shell, Adobe Express

Senior Software Engineer role at Adobe Express, building next-gen creative tools using Web Components and modern JavaScript technologies.

Senior Software Engineer

Senior Software Engineer role at Adobe's Frame.io, building cutting-edge web applications for video collaboration using React, TypeScript, and GraphQL.

Expert Frontend Engineer with Page Speed Focus

Senior Frontend Engineer role at Adobe focusing on web performance optimization and customer success, offering competitive compensation $133,900-$242,000 annually.

Senior Frontend Engineer - Adobe Experience Cloud

Senior Frontend Engineer position at Adobe Experience Cloud, focusing on building robust user interfaces and mentoring team members while working with modern web technologies.

Software Development Engineer 3

Senior Software Development Engineer role at Adobe, focusing on building exceptional web experiences using modern technologies like React, Java, and Node.js.